Why High‑Risk SaaS Merchants Need Specialized Gateways
High‑risk SaaS models—such as subscription‑based gambling, adult content, or cryptocurrency services—face higher charge‑back ratios and stricter underwriting. A generic gateway often lacks the tools to mitigate these challenges, leading to:
- Frequent account suspensions due to vague risk policies
- Limited access to alternative payment methods that local customers prefer
- Inadequate fraud‑prevention layers, exposing the business to costly disputes
Choosing a gateway designed for high‑risk merchants equips you with advanced risk scoring, flexible settlement schedules, and dedicated support teams that understand the SaaS lifecycle.
Regulatory Landscape in Burkina Faso and Noumbiel
Burkina Faso’s financial authority enforces anti‑money‑laundering (AML) and know‑your‑customer (KYC) standards that apply nationwide, including the remote province of Noumbiel. While the country encourages digital transformation, compliance remains non‑negotiable for high‑risk operators.
Key compliance checkpoints
- Obtain a local payment‑service licence or partner with a licensed aggregator.
- Implement real‑time identity verification for every subscriber.
- Maintain transaction logs for a minimum period as defined by the regulator.
Failure to meet these requirements can result in fines, gateway termination, or even criminal investigation. Therefore, a gateway that already embeds AML/KYC modules can dramatically reduce your compliance burden.
Key Features of a Robust High‑Risk Payment Solution
When evaluating providers, focus on the following capabilities, each of which directly impacts conversion and risk management:
- Multi‑currency processing – Accept payments in CFA Franc, USD, and emerging digital currencies without hidden conversion fees.
- Adaptive fraud engine – Machine‑learning models that adjust to the transaction patterns typical of SaaS subscriptions.
- Charge‑back mitigation tools – Automated dispute response templates and evidence‑gathering dashboards.
- Local payment methods – Mobile money (e.g., Orange Money), bank transfers, and prepaid vouchers popular in Noumbiel.
- Transparent pricing – Tiered rates that reflect risk level rather than a flat punitive surcharge.
These features not only protect revenue but also build trust with customers who expect seamless, secure checkout experiences.
Choosing the Right Provider: A Practical Checklist
Before signing a contract, run through this concise checklist to ensure the gateway aligns with your strategic goals:
- Is the provider licensed to operate in West Africa, specifically Burkina Faso?
- Do they offer a sandbox environment for testing integration without live transactions?
- What is the average settlement time for high‑risk merchants?
- Are there dedicated account managers fluent in French and familiar with Noumbiel’s market?
- Does the solution include API documentation that supports recurring billing and webhook notifications?
Answering these questions helps you avoid hidden fees and service gaps that often plague high‑risk SaaS ventures.
